Neil Patrick Harris

Neil Patrick Harris is a multi-hyphenate known for iconic roles on both stage and screen, such as Barney Stinson in How I Met Your Mother, Count Olaf in the Netflix adaptation of A Series of Unfortunate Events, and the title role in the Tony Award-winning Broadway production of Hedwig and the Angry Inch (Tony, Drama League and Drama Desk Awards). He has also served as a beloved host of the Tony Awards, the Primetime Emmy Awards, and the Academy Awards. Neil is the author of the international and New York Times bestselling fiction series The Magic Misfits (over one million copies sold), produced and starred in the Netflix comedy series Uncoupled, and joined the cast of the BBC’s Dr. Who 60th Anniversary Special.
